Rousseau, Nature, and the Problem of the Good Life
An interpretation of Rousseau's thought that focuses on his complex concept of nature as one major key to understanding his legacy to modern political philosophy. It examines his efforts to show why, despite a challenge from science, nature can remain a standard for human behaviour.
